No, I'm not worried about copyright infringement. Actually the depressing thing is that, if a large media company felt like it, they could probably lean on individuals running websites and get what they want whether it was a legally defensible case or not. Case in point, Jason Kottke (the source of the link, actually), when he put up a spoiler of the Ken Jennings loss. He was issued a cease-and-desist; whereas a Washington Post article had the same information and was not issued a similar request (demand?). Of course individuals don't have the resources to fight legal challenges against, say, Sony. It was an interesting read, nonetheless.
